Output c6bf7d82676de8d1d78aa92d50f16a52d23c9393f8625aaf72aef030d0a8c09d:52

value
6577893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0bbf089e9a2e0bd8078ca0289adc8a661574343 OP_EQUAL
address
3GLuBWVQRhuSKevSNzevFhnLS5VigkHfSU
transaction
c6bf7d82676de8d1d78aa92d50f16a52d23c9393f8625aaf72aef030d0a8c09d
spent
true